Sr. Software Development Engineer in Test - iOS
New Yesterday
We are seeking a highly motivated and experienced Sr. Software Development Engineer in Test (SDET) to join our team reporting to the Director of Software Engineering. You will work to improve software quality by implementing testing processes throughout the entire software development lifecycle for our mobile apps, firmware, and cloud services. This includes embedding automated tests into development pipelines and creating efficient processes for resolving any bugs or defects.
Considering making an application for this job Check all the details in this job description, and then click on Apply.
You will take a holistic approach to software quality and help shape the direction of software testing. This means testing code changes early and often to improve quality and reduce the overall burden on the development teams. To be successful, you will bring a strong technical acumen and soft skills.
Please note that this is an on-site role and you must live within a reasonable
commuting distance of the office in San Diego, CA.
Applicants must be authorized to work for any employer in the U.S. We are unable to sponsor or take over sponsorship of an employment visa at this time.
Responsibilities
Test Development and Validation
Design, develop, execute, and maintain product E2E tests for system integrations
Ownership of the test plan & validation strategy for software releases
Maintain the continuous integration environment
Define system tests to assess correctness of system functionality
Automate screenshot testing against the GUI requirements spec
Automate Bluetooth testing of a medical device peripheral
Run tests, analyze test results against expectations, and help debug observed quality issues
Maintenance and Sustaining
Test compatibility of new iOS releases and Apple phones
Regression test and validate open-source package updates
Stay informed on known bugs and vulnerabilities in open-source package dependencies
Actively monitor for product and data quality issues during internal testing and clinical trials
Qualification of new development tools (e.g., Xcode)
What you bring
At minimum, a Bachelor's degree in Computer Science, Engineering, or related field
5+ years of software testing experience
Programming experience using Swift or another OOP language
Expertise writing Cucumber tests in the Gherkin language for a native iOS application
Xcode XCUITest development experience
Experience developing & validating software in a regulated industry (e.g., medical, government, etc.)
Familiarity with writing protocols for software verification and validation
Demonstrated cross-functional collaboration
Knowledge of test frameworks and strategies for iOS, Google Cloud Platform, and Node.js
What we offer
A no-jerk policy - we seek the best and brightest talent who are fun to work with
Equity - we are just setting off on this journey, and you will get in from the start
Excellent health benefits
- Location:
- San Diego, CA
- Category:
- Healthcare And Medical